## What Do Cambridge Plumbers Typically Charge Per Hour?

Most Cambridge plumbers charge between £45 and £75 per hour for standard work. This covers their time, expertise, and van costs.

Emergency calls outside normal hours cost significantly more. Night-time or weekend work often adds 50% to 100% extra. If you call a plumber at 2am on Sunday, expect premium rates. Bank holidays also attract higher fees across Cambridge.

Some plumbers charge from the moment they leave their depot. Others start timing once they arrive at your home. Always clarify this before booking. Fixed-price quotes are often better value if the plumber can assess the work properly beforehand.

## How Much Is a Callout Fee in Cambridge?

Most Cambridge plumbers charge £40-90 for a callout visit. This covers their time arriving at your property and diagnosing the problem.

The callout fee sometimes gets deducted from the final bill if you proceed with repairs. Some plumbers don’t charge callouts if you book them for work. This is worth negotiating, especially for larger jobs. Always ask about callout policies when you phone around for quotes.

Emergency callout fees cost considerably more. Weekend or night visits might charge £80-150 just to arrive. This reflects the inconvenience of working outside normal hours.

## What Do Common Plumbing Jobs Cost in Cambridge?

Straightforward repairs typically cost £150-300 in Cambridge. A new tap installation, for example, might be £180-250. Fixing a leaky pipe could range from £150-400 depending on complexity.

More involved work costs more. A new bathroom suite installation might be £2,000-5,000. Boiler repairs average £300-800. Drain unblocking costs £150-500 depending on blockage severity and location.

Emergency repairs like burst pipes need immediate attention. Expect to pay premium rates plus parts costs. Most Cambridge plumbers stock common parts, but rare items might require ordering.

## Should You Get Multiple Quotes from Cambridge Plumbers?

Always get at least two or three quotes before committing to work. Different plumbers price jobs differently based on their experience and approach.

Getting quotes takes 10-15 minutes per plumber. You’ll spot pricing patterns quickly. If one quote’s drastically higher or lower, ask why. Some plumbers work more efficiently than others, which affects pricing.

Written quotes protect you legally. Ensure the quote includes all parts, labour, and any callout fees. Ask about payment methods and whether they accept staged payments for larger jobs.

## FAQ

**Q: Do Cambridge plumbers charge more for weekends?**
A: Yes, most Cambridge plumbers charge 50-100% extra for weekend work. Sunday callouts are typically the most expensive.

**Q: Can I negotiate plumber prices in Cambridge?**
A: You can discuss pricing, especially for larger jobs or if you’re flexible with timing. However, don’t expect dramatic discounts.

**Q: What’s included in a plumber’s hourly rate?**
A: Hourly rates cover their time, expertise, and vehicle costs. Parts are usually charged separately on top.

**Q: Are emergency plumbers more expensive in Cambridge?**
A: Significantly yes. Emergency callout fees alone might be £100-150, then add hourly rates on top.

**Q: Should I book a plumber for a non-urgent visit instead?**
A: Absolutely. Non-emergency work during business hours costs roughly half the price of emergency callouts.
